Indigenous Urbanism is a podcast about the spaces we inhabit, and the indigenous community leaders who are shaping and decolonising those envirnments. Indigenous communities in settler-colonial nations are increasingly seeking to re-assert their identities and reinstate place-based relationships within their traditional territories. With the advent of reconciliation movements and Treaty settlements in Aotearoa, Indigenous communities are gaining greater control and influence over the design of their physical environments.
